The answer to your question is: 0.02 M
Explanation:
Data
mass = 5.57 g
volume = 2.50 L
Formula
Molarity = [tex]\frac{moles}{volume (liters)}[/tex]
Process
1.- Calculate the molecular mass of CaClâ‚‚
Molecular mass 0f CaClâ‚‚ = 40 + (35.5 x 2) = 111 g
2.- Calculate the moles of CaClâ‚‚ in 5.57 g
                111 g of CaCl₂  ---------------- 1 mol
                 5.57 g of CaCl₂ -------------  x
                  x = (5.57 x 1) / 111
                  x = 0.050 moles of CaCl₂
3.- Calculate molarity
[tex]Molarity = \frac{0.050}{2.5}[/tex]
   Molarity = 0.02
